LightBridge Hospice was awarded The Joint Commission's
Gold Seal of Approval for compliance with the organization’s
national standards for health care quality and safety.

The Joint Commission is an independent nonprofit
organization that accredits and certifies more than 15,000
health care organizations and programs in the United States.
